Key Features to Consider for Long Range Electric Scooters
When shopping for a long range electric scooter, there are several key features to consider. One of the most important is the battery life and range of the scooter. Look for scooters with high-capacity batteries that can provide a range of at least 20-30 miles on a single charge. Another important feature is the motor power and speed of the scooter. A more powerful motor will provide faster acceleration and a higher top speed, but may also reduce the range of the scooter. Additionally, consider the weight and portability of the scooter, as well as the durability and build quality.
The suspension and braking system of the scooter are also crucial features to consider. A good suspension system will provide a smooth ride and help to absorb bumps and shocks, while a reliable braking system is essential for safety. Look for scooters with high-quality disc brakes or regenerative braking systems. The tires and wheels of the scooter are also important, as they can affect the ride quality and traction. Consider scooters with wide, high-quality tires that provide good grip and stability.
In addition to these features, consider the comfort and ergonomics of the scooter. Look for scooters with adjustable handlebars and a comfortable riding position. Some scooters also come with features such as cruise control, LED lights, and Bluetooth connectivity. These features can enhance the riding experience and provide additional convenience and safety. Range and Battery Life
The range and battery life of an electric scooter are crucial factors to consider, especially if you plan to use it for commuting or traveling long distances. A good electric scooter should have a battery that can last for at least 20 miles on a single charge. However, some models can travel up to 50 miles or more, depending on the type of battery and the terrain. It’s essential to consider the type of battery used in the scooter, as some batteries are more efficient than others. Lithium-ion batteries, for example, are known for their high energy density and long lifespan.
When evaluating the range and battery life of an electric scooter, it’s also important to consider the factors that affect its performance. For example, the terrain, climate, and rider weight can all impact the scooter’s range. If you plan to ride in hilly or mountainous areas, you may need a scooter with a more powerful battery to handle the inclines. Similarly, if you’re a heavier rider, you may need a scooter with a more efficient battery to ensure you get the range you need. By considering these factors, you can choose an electric scooter that meets your needs and provides the best possible range and battery life.
Motor Power and Speed
The motor power and speed of an electric scooter are also critical factors to consider. A more powerful motor can provide faster acceleration and higher top speeds, making it ideal for commuting or traveling long distances. However, it’s essential to consider the type of motor used in the scooter, as some motors are more efficient than others. Brushless motors, for example, are known for their high efficiency and reliability. When evaluating the motor power and speed of an electric scooter, it’s also important to consider the scooter’s gearing and transmission. A scooter with a well-designed gearing system can provide smoother acceleration and better hill climbing ability.
When choosing an electric scooter, it’s also important to consider the top speed and acceleration. If you plan to use the scooter for commuting, you may want a model that can reach higher speeds, such as 25-30 mph. However, if you plan to use the scooter for recreational purposes, a lower top speed may be sufficient. Additionally, consider the scooter’s acceleration, as a faster acceleration can make it easier to merge with traffic or climb hills. By considering these factors, you can choose an electric scooter that provides the right balance of power and speed for your needs.

What is the average range of long range electric scooters?
The average range of long range electric scooters can vary depending on several factors, including the model, battery capacity, and riding conditions. Generally, long range electric scooters can travel between 20 to 50 miles on a single charge, with some high-end models reaching ranges of up to 75 miles or more. This makes them ideal for commuters who need to travel longer distances without worrying about running out of power.
When choosing a long range electric scooter, it’s essential to consider the terrain and conditions you’ll be riding in. If you’ll be riding in hilly or mountainous areas, you may need a scooter with a more powerful motor and larger battery to maintain a consistent range. Additionally, factors such as rider weight, speed, and wind resistance can also impact the scooter’s range, so it’s crucial to research and test different models to find the one that best suits your needs.

How do I maintain and repair my long range electric scooter?
Maintaining and repairing your long range electric scooter is essential to ensure its longevity and performance. Regular maintenance tasks include checking and maintaining the tire pressure, cleaning the scooter, and lubricating the moving parts. You should also check the battery and charging system regularly, and follow the manufacturer’s instructions for charging and storing the scooter. Additionally, you may need to replace parts such as the brake pads, tires, and bearings over time, which can be done with the help of a professional mechanic or by following DIY tutorials.
When repairing your long range electric scooter, it’s essential to follow proper safety procedures and use genuine replacement parts. You should also refer to the manufacturer’s instructions and guidelines for troubleshooting and repair. If you’re not comfortable with DIY repairs, it’s recommended to take the scooter to a professional mechanic or the manufacturer’s authorized service center. By maintaining and repairing your scooter regularly, you can ensure its optimal performance, extend its lifespan, and enjoy a safe and reliable riding experience.
